Patent attributes
A method of providing improved quality of Internet Protocol (IP) video content over the Internet involves, for an item of content, calculating a score representative of a likelihood that a particular viewer will order the item of content; if the score is greater than a threshold score T, then downloading a portion of the item of content from a content provider, and storing the portion of the item of content in a storage location local to the viewer; if the viewer elects to view the item of video content, then: retrieving the stored portion of the item of video content, streaming an augmentation to the stored portion of the item of video content from the content provider, and combining the stored portion with the augmentation of the stored portion to produce an improved resolution version of the item of video content. This process can be carried out in an IPTV adapter. This abstract is not to be considered limiting, since other embodiments may deviate from the features described in this abstract.